Education Appeals Panel member

As an Education Appeals Panel member, you’ll listen to families about why they believe their child should be offered a different school place, hear the school’s position, and make an impartial decision based on the evidence.

Experience required

Able to pass a Level 1 Children PVG Disclosure Check (cost reimbursed)
You must be:
· A parent of a child of school age, OR
· Someone with experience in education, OR
· Someone with knowledge about educational condition in Midlothian

Support
Training details

Full training in April-May 2026 (online, plus reading materials)
· Mock hearings which will allow panel members to observe and understand the hearing process before participating in an arranged hearing.
· Support from experienced clerks at every hearing
